Hey Folks,
I know this has been talked to death but here goes anyway. I have decided I
can fill, prime, and sand til doomsday or just paint it. I think I have
gotten it reasonably smooth but have ended up with NOT a complete covering
of Polyfiber UV Smoothprime in the process. I am determined to go no further
with the sanding portion to remove anymore or put anymore on now that it is
smooth. But will someone give me a definitive formula of primers (epoxy?)
and paint combinations, including brands, potion numbers etc, that will act
as a UV blocker and give me a glossy, repairable/upgradable paint job that
can be color sanded (by someone else if desired) but not requirred, to get
the "wet look"? I hope this makes sense. I guess in a nutshell, can I get UV
protection from the finish process, not relying on a partial coat of UV
smooth prime?
What about the shop in Lakeland that did so many Europas? I know they
preferred no pre-priming at all. What products did they use? Can anyone tell
me the details of their mix? They sure made Bob Berube's plane sparkle.

Hi! Troy
I used CA 40,000 by Pro-Desoto International Ltd. …..In the Uk they are at “Sealands and Coatings”, Darlington Road, Shilton. Tel 0044(0) 1388 772541
(or more correctly the RAF used my supplied paint for me!) The Aero Industry use this paint extensively and I was given to understand that Air France used it exclusively 7 years ago. It must have a good “key” surface though. They are a little difficult to deal with though ….usually supply to “big” customers!
I had a Sales Rep mobile number Ian Toole 0044(0) 777 814 0567 but he may have moved on by now.
Google UK puts them as a subsidiary of PPG Industries California.
Mine is an excellent hard gloss finish needing only washing for maintenance. The “key” surface is very important though otherwise you just may get the occasional osmosis bubble, and any base coat pin holes will need “ragging”.
